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Reja de Entrada Automática en Bellflower

Cuál es el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más barato en Bellflower?

Actualmente el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más accequible en Bellflower está en Olive Tree listado en $1,375.

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Bellflower?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Bellflower es $2,168.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ática más grande en Bellflower?

A día de hoy el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ática con más metros cuadrados en Bellflower una unidad de 1,185 a partir de $1,895 en Seaport Village.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Bellflower?

El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Bellflower es actualmente de 484 sq ft.
